Total Time: 3 hrs 10 minsCategory: DinnerCalories: 312 per serving1. Place chicken in a large Ziploc bag. Drizzle with olive oil. Season liberally with salt and pepper. Add oregano, basil, thyme, and garlic to the bag. Seal the bag, toss to coat the chicken. You can let the chicken marinate in the refrigerator for a couple of hours (or overnight), or you can just use it right away.
2. Place onion and carrots in the bottom of a slow cooker. Top with chicken and herbs from the bag. Squeeze lemon juice over top.
3. Cover and cook on LOW for about 4-6 hours, or on HIGH for about 2-3 hours. Season with additional salt and pepper, to taste. Chop chicken or shred with a fork before serving.
4. Pile the chicken on top of pita bread, rice, or salad. Garnish with Tzatziki sauce, feta cheese, olives, and fresh veggies.

1. Add the chicken breast and onions to a slow cooker. Drizzle with olive oil. Season liberally with salt and pepper. Add oregano, basil, thyme, and garlic. Squeeze the lemon over the top.
2. Cover and cook on low for about 4-6 hours, or on high for about 2-3 hours. Season with additional salt and pepper, to taste. Chop chicken or shred with a fork before serving.
3. Pile the chicken on top of warmed pita bread. Top with your choice of optional toppings: tzatziki sauce, feta cheese, olives, and fresh veggies.
